Output 5958780a7426f61fcf93a217127399003caa80ff27a234ace985ddc6ca4d6b94:1

value
1501443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 111ca9a598f49b658bbf3c289bf0be5ac30e60f4 OP_EQUAL
address
33FVkKgqdhfs65BRGoNydju9PXpcPEzG5H
transaction
5958780a7426f61fcf93a217127399003caa80ff27a234ace985ddc6ca4d6b94
spent
true